Dicas De Recuperação Da API Win32 Com Um Clique

Remova malware, proteja seus arquivos e otimize o desempenho com um clique!

Se o seu computador pessoal mostrar erro da API Win32 quando clicado, você deve verificar os métodos de recuperação desses produtos.

Se o usuário clicar com o botão direito, o cursor pode estar na área de compras da janela, o painel será associado às mensagens únicas.

Como corrigir falhas do Windows

Você tem um computador lento? Nesse caso, talvez seja hora de considerar algum software de reparo do Windows. O Restoro é fácil de usar e corrigirá erros comuns em seu PC rapidamente. Este software pode até recuperar arquivos de discos rígidos corrompidos ou pen drives danificados. Ele também tem a capacidade de eliminar vírus com um clique de um botão!

  • 1. Baixe e instale o Reimage
  • 2. Inicie o programa e selecione o dispositivo que deseja verificar
  • 3. Clique no botão Digitalizar para iniciar o processo de digitalização

  • Lembre-se que esta área personalizada faz parte de qualquer tipo de janela específica, com exceção de toda a borda. Para mais informações sobre áreas de clientes, consulte O que é sem dúvida uma janela?

    Coordenadas do mouse

    win32 api leva clique do mouse

    Em quase virtualmente dessas mensagens, o parâmetro lParam engloba as harmonizações xey de cada uma de nossas fêmeas de mouse. O quarto menos significativo contém 04 bits de lParam exatamente nessa coordenada x, e os próximos 16 são formulados a partir das partes da coordenada y. Use GET_X_LPARAM e / junto com GET_Y_LPARAM para unbox macros para correspondências lParam.

    win32 api leva clique do mouse

      int é igual a xPos GET_X_LPARAM (lParam);int yPos = GET_Y_LPARAM (lParam); 
    

    No Windows de 64 bits, lParam é um valor de 64 bits. A maioria dos 8 bits significativos de lParam incluem não executados. A documentação do MSDN descreve que esses lParam são "palavra menos perceptível" e "palavra mais significativa". No caso de 64 bits, as pessoas geralmente são os itens menos significativos e as palavras são menos do que um determinado 32 bits menos significativo. As macros restauram os valores corretos Se e quando o cliente as usar, você estará sempre protegido.

    As coordenadas do mouse são especificadas perto de p, não em p independente de dispositivo (DIP), e geralmente são medidas de forma comparável à localização da janela do cliente. As coordenadas são valores privados. As posições acima e à esquerda da área do proprietário contêm coordenadas negativas, o que provavelmente será importante se você estiver seguindo a posição do mouse fora da janela real. Veremos como isso funciona no tema da festa, Detectando movimentos do mouse fora do quadro da janela .

    Indicadores adicionais

    O parâmetro wParam contém um novo sinalizador bit a bit Of ou Flag que provou cada estado dos outros switches coelho, bem como as teclas SHIFT e CTRL.

    sinal de aviso Valor

    MK_CONTROL A tecla CTRL foi pressionada. Esquerda mk_lbutton O botão PC era difícil. MK_MBUTTON O botão do meio do laptop ou do mouse do computador foi pressionado. MK_RBUTTON Botão direito do mouse pressionado no pc. MK_SHIFT O ponto crítico SHIFT foi pressionado. MK_XBUTTON1 O botão XBUTTON1 foi pressionado. MK_XBUTTON2 O botão XBUTTON2 foi de fato pressionado.

    A ausência de um sinalizador bom significa que a solução ou tecla correspondente não foi pressionada. Por exemplo, para descobrir se você vê, a tecla CTRL é pressionada:

      nos casos em que é real (wParam & MK_CONTROL) {... 
    

    Se os proprietários precisarem encontrar o status junto com teclas adicionais, como CTRL e SHIFT, use a função GetKeyState, que é considerada frequentemente descrita no local Input .

    Mensagens de janela WM_XBUTTONDOWN a WM_XBUTTONUP geralmente se aplicam a XBUTTON1 e XBUTTON2. O parâmetro wParam especifica qual botão foi realmente pressionado.

    botão UINT

      em torno do software = GET_XBUTTON_WPARAM(wParam);if == (tecla XBUTTON1)    // Empregos XBUTTON1 foram pressionados.caso contrário se (botão == XBUTTON2)   // XBUTTON2 pressionou um pouco demais. 
    

    Clique duas vezes na janela

    a não aceita notificações de clique duplo por padrão. Para obter cliques, defina o intervalo CS_DBLCLKS duas vezes na estrutura WNDCLASS se suas famílias armazenam a classe window.

      WNDCLASS wc implica;    wc = estilo CS_DBLCLKS;    /* Especifica outros membros da forma. */    Registrar classe(&wc); 
    

    Se você definir todos os sinalizadores CS_DBLCLKS como mostrado, a janela da casa coletará notificações de clique duplo. Clique duas vezes, provavelmente, será implicado por uma janela com a palavra "DBLCLK" em seu nome. Para expressar isso, clicar duas vezes no pato esquerdo importante cria o seguinte tópico de mensagem:

    WM_LBUTTONDOWN
    WM_LBUTTONUP
    WM_LBUTTONBLCLK
    WM_LBUTTONUP

    Normalmente, uma mensagem WM_LBUTTONDOWN recebida se torna uma mensagem WM_LBUTTONBLCLK . Os tweets equivalentes são fornecidos à direita, para o botão do coração e para os links XBUTTON.

    Até obter um duplo clique, você verá um e-mail informando que é impossível que ajude a dizer com certeza que o clique único do mouse é o início de um clique em grupo. Portanto, geralmente a ação de clique duplo deve, na verdade, continuar uma ação que ocorre no clique inicial do mouse. Para o argumento, presente no shell do Windows, um clique decide a pasta e um clique duplo abre sua pasta atual.

    Mensagens de mouse não cliente

    De fato, um conjunto separado no lugar de mensagens é definido para eventos de mouse sensíveis que ocorrem em áreas não clientes de todas as janelas. Seu nome comercial contém as mensagens dos indivíduos de "NC". O exemplo para alcançar WM_NCLBUTTONDOWN é o mesmo não-cliente de WM_LBUTTONDOWN . Um aplicativo normal nem sempre intercepta essas ideias porque o objetivo defwindowproc trata essas mensagens corretamente. No entanto, muitos podem ser úteis para vários recursos refinados. Por exemplo, você deve aplicar essas mensagens para implementar os hábitos na barra de título. Normalmente, antes de processar essas mensagens, as famílias devem entregá-las ao DefWindowProc, se verificarem que o farão mais tarde. Caso contrário, todos os seus aplicativos desabilitarão recursos padrão como arrastar e soltar ou sem dificuldade em minimizar a janela.

    Próximo

  • Artigo
  • 3 minutos se sua organização quiser ler
  • Seu PC está lento? Você está recebendo a temida tela azul da morte? Então é hora de baixar Reimage � o melhor software de resolução de erros do Windows!